Quote:
Originally Posted by Crackseed View Post
If I had any genuine faith in my ability to repair this kind of damage and I don't - I have 0 shame in admitting it's beyond me to do. While the wait is unfortunate, knowing it'll be handled by professionals and cost me very little is good peace of mind
I had a similar incident and I did the repair myself. Saved myself the insurance headache and a couple grand. The fender and bumper come off relatively easy. Judging from your pics.. You'll need a new bumper + paint and some elbow grease to get everything to line up.
